Parking lot quilting bee makes the local news!

6/1/2020

1 Comment

 
Our very own Queen Bees made the local news when they met up at a local parking lot for some socially-distant quilting! Click here to see the article on the website or read the article below:

S
ocial distancing has put a crimp into many activities so, when you can't meet at a friend's home, you have to make due. And the Queen Bees — a subgroup of the Brandywine Valley Quilting Guild — have been setting up in parking lots.
Often the choice of which lot depends on what they feel like eating that day, one said in the Painters Crossing parking lot near Nudy's on Sunday. The Bees have been around for four years, but the larger group had been around for more than 30.
Members of the group agreed that the lockdown has made getting together more difficult, but the parking lots work. COVID-19 has also affected guild meetings and quilting classes. Even they are being done on Zoom.
But the group has been productive. Members began working on a quilt last August that's to be raffled off at a quilt show planned for October in Brookhaven.
